    摘要: An integrated circuit may include an operation amplifier, a first capacitor, a plurality of second capacitors, and/or a switching circuit. The operational amplifier may have a first input terminal, a second input terminal, and/or an output terminal. The first capacitor may have a first terminal and a second terminal. The second terminal of the first capacitor may be connected to the first input terminal of the operational amplifier. The plurality of second capacitors may each have a first terminal and a second terminal. The second terminal of each of the second capacitors may be connected to the second input terminal of the operational amplifier. The switching circuit may include a plurality of switches configured to switch in response to a plurality of switching signals. The switching circuit may be configured to transmit a reference voltage to the first terminal of the first capacitor and the first terminals of the second capacitors and/or connect the first input terminal of the operational amplifier to the output terminal of the operational amplifier during a first period. The switching circuit may be configured to isolate the first terminal of the first capacitor from the reference voltage, transmit a voltage selected from at least two selection voltages to the first terminals of the second capacitors, and/or connect the first terminal of the first capacitor to the output terminal of the operational amplifier during a second period.

    摘要: Disclosed herein are a transmission line of coaxial type and a manufacturing method thereof, capable of preventing a radiative signal loss of signal lines during transmission of an RF signal and removing signal interference between adjacent signal lines, thus allowing signal lines to be compactly arrayed during a manufacture of IC, and reducing a dimension of the IC. The transmission line of coaxial type includes grooves provided on a semiconductor substrate, a first ground layer, an electrically conductive epoxy coated on a flat part of the first ground layer except the grooves, second ground layers provided on the electrically conductive epoxy, a dielectric film provided at a position above the grooves and the second ground layers, a third ground layer provided on an upper surface of the dielectric film, and signal lines placed in spaces defined by the grooves and a lower surface of the dielectric film. In this case, the electrically conductive epoxy is coated on only contact surfaces of the first and second ground layers, and the signal lines are attached to the lower surface of the dielectric film.

    摘要: A digital to analog converter includes first and second capacitors, an operational amplifier and a switching circuit. The operational amplifier includes first and second input terminals and an output terminal, the second input terminal receiving a reference voltage. The switching circuit includes multiple switches which switch in response to corresponding switching signals. The switching circuit connects the second capacitor between the output terminal and the first input terminal of the operational amplifier, while respectively sending first and second voltages to first and second terminals of the first capacitor during a first period. The switching circuit also connects the first capacitor between the output terminal and the first input terminal of the operational amplifier, while respectively sending third and fourth voltages to first and second terminals of the second capacitor during a second period consecutively following the first period.
